6.1 Connecting the Ground Cables
1. It is essential to connect the ground cable to the WIT inverter before connecting other cables to
prevent personal injury or device damage.
2. All non-current-carrying metal parts and the enclosures of the devices of the energy storage
system, including the rack and the enclosures of the combiner box, the distribution panel, the
inverter and the battery should be properly grounded.
3. For a single WIT inverter, connect a ground cable to the ground point on the chassis shell. For a
system with multiple WIT inverters connected in parallel, ensure that the enclosures of the WIT
Inverters, the metal racks of the PV modules and the batteries are connected to the same area to
achieve equipotential bonding.
4. The position of the ground points of the WIT 50-100K Storage/Hybrid Inverter is shown in fig
6.1. You can find the ground points after removing the right cover plate.
Fig 6.1 Ground points
NOTE:
1. Keep the lightning protection grounding at the greatest possible distance from the protective grounding.
2. Protect the terminals of the ground cables against rain and do not expose the them to open air.
3. Tighten the screws to a torque of 60 kgf·cm.
6.2 Connection on the AC Side
● Before connecting cables, ensure that the DC switches on the WIT Inverter are
OFF. Turn off the switches and breakers on the AC side and the battery side.
Otherwise, the high voltages of the WIT Inverter may result in electric shocks.
● Only qualified and trained electrical technicians are allowed to perform operations.
Technicians must observe instructions in this manual and local regulations.
● High voltages may cause electric shocks and serious injury. Please do not touch
the inverter in operation.
● Do not place inflammable and explosive materials around the WIT Inverter.
